On Fri, Apr 17, 2026 at 02:28:17PM +0530, Riana Tauro wrote:
> Uncorrectable errors from different endpoints in the device are steered to
> the USP(Upstream Switch Port) which is a PCI Advanced Error Reporting (AER)
> Compliant device. Downgrade all the errors to non-fatal to prevent PCIe
> bus driver from triggering a Secondary Bus Reset (SBR). This allows error
> detection, containment and recovery in the driver.
> 
> The Uncorrectable Error Severity Register has the 'Uncorrectable
> Internal Error Severity' set to fatal by default. Set this to
> non-fatal and unmask the error.

> +#ifdef CONFIG_PCIEAER
> +static void aer_unmask_and_downgrade_internal_error(struct xe_device *xe)
> +{
> +	struct pci_dev *pdev = to_pci_dev(xe->drm.dev);
> +	struct pci_dev *vsp, *usp;
> +	u32 aer_uncorr_mask, aer_uncorr_sev, aer_uncorr_status;
> +	u16 aer_cap;
> +
> +	/*
> +	 * Device Hierarchy:
> +	 *
> +	 * Upstream Switch Port (USP)--> Virtual Switch Port (VSP)--> SGunit (GPU endpoint)
> +	 */
> +	vsp = pci_upstream_bridge(pdev);
> +	if (!vsp)
> +		return;
> +
> +	usp = pci_upstream_bridge(vsp);
> +	if (!usp)
> +		return;
> +
> +	aer_cap = usp->aer_cap;
> +
> +	if (!aer_cap) {
> +		dev_info(&usp->dev, "USP doesn't support AER capability\n");
> +		return;
> +	}
> +
> +	/*
> +	 * Clear any stale Uncorrectable Internal Error Status event in Uncorrectable Error
> +	 * Status Register.
> +	 */
> +	pci_read_config_dword(usp, aer_cap + PCI_ERR_UNCOR_STATUS, &aer_uncorr_status);
> +	if (aer_uncorr_status & PCI_ERR_UNC_INTN)
> +		pci_write_config_dword(usp, aer_cap + PCI_ERR_UNCOR_STATUS, PCI_ERR_UNC_INTN);
> +
> +	/*
> +	 * All errors are steered to USP which is a PCIe AER Compliant device.
> +	 * Downgrade all the errors to non-fatal to prevent PCIe bus driver
> +	 * from triggering a Secondary Bus Reset (SBR). This allows error
> +	 * detection, containment and recovery in the driver.
> +	 *
> +	 * The Uncorrectable Error Severity Register has the 'Uncorrectable
> +	 * Internal Error Severity' set to fatal by default. Set this to
> +	 * non-fatal and unmask the error.
> +	 */
> +
> +	/* Initialize Uncorrectable Error Severity Register */
> +	pci_read_config_dword(usp, aer_cap + PCI_ERR_UNCOR_SEVER, &aer_uncorr_sev);
> +	aer_uncorr_sev &= ~PCI_ERR_UNC_INTN;
> +	pci_write_config_dword(usp, aer_cap + PCI_ERR_UNCOR_SEVER, aer_uncorr_sev);
> +
> +	/* Initialize Uncorrectable Error Mask Register */
> +	pci_read_config_dword(usp, aer_cap + PCI_ERR_UNCOR_MASK, &aer_uncorr_mask);
> +	aer_uncorr_mask &= ~PCI_ERR_UNC_INTN;
> +	pci_write_config_dword(usp, aer_cap + PCI_ERR_UNCOR_MASK, aer_uncorr_mask);
> +
> +	pci_save_state(usp);
> +}
> +#endif

> +/**
> + * xe_ras_init - Initialize Xe RAS
> + * @xe: xe device instance
> + *
> + * Initialize Xe RAS
> + */
> +void xe_ras_init(struct xe_device *xe)
> +{
> +	if (!xe->info.has_sysctrl)
> +		return;
> +
> +#ifdef CONFIG_PCIEAER
> +	aer_unmask_and_downgrade_internal_error(xe);

If we fail silently we'd most likely be clueless why RAS isn't working.
So either add error log here or have an explicit success log inside
downgrade function.

Raag

> +#endif
> +}
